The Cord of Three Strands symbolizes the bond of emuna, the marriage that's built on the deep and durable foundations of emuna. The triple-stranded cord represents the Creator, the groom, and the bride. Together, intertwined, they form a braid that symbolizes the fusion of one man, one woman, and the Almighty in the marriage.
